  • A Letter to the Thanyan Enclave in Aquor

    A letter in bold handwriting is received at the Thayan enclave:

    I have been instructed by both Salarius Emiliana Blackwell of the Sundarian Legion and Sergeant Knoll of the Blackwood Company to inform you of troubling events in the Spine. I, along with Blackwell and a third party, climbed the Spine recently only to encounter hordes of undead under the command of Dark Advent necromancers. Farther up the mountin, we eventually encountered some . . . thing performing some sort of ritual slaying of Dark Advent necromancers. We attempted to engage the thing, but it escaped to a refuge in the mountains.

    It is true that the Dark Advent is believed to be non-existant, but these events have proven otherwise. If you require more proof than this letter, please contact the Legion as they recovered a number of the corpses for further investigation. In the mean time, it is recommended that the Enclave increase its readyness. If the Dark Advent is using the Spine as a base of operations, then it is likely that Aquor will be their first target.

    Maneae Strongarm
    Grunt of the Blackwood Company

    Dear Grunt...

    We have inquired the military faction as stated, and found that the corpses held no identifying marks of the Dark Advant more than their robes. As well none of them seemed to be over the apparent age of nineteen. With all present evidence along with examination of the bones of the undead as you have stated, we have concluded that this was a group of young adults, disguised at the defunct Dark Advant, whom have started to dabble in necromancy. Their presence in the spine can only be concluded as either an attempt to gain favor with a stronger faction or to snatch up some of the undead present to bolster their ranks.

    We are grateful for your timely response to this matter as well as to the fact you chose to send this information to us. We look forward to future dealings.
